Cell communication types (i. e. paracrine, autocrine vs hormone) Ligand-gated ion channels: ligand binding opens an ion channel. Tyrosine kinase: activates protein kinases which phosphorylate and activate a protein; is a receptor enzyme. Gpcr: most common; trimeric; crosses membrane 7 times; gdp gtp activates it; can activate adenyl cyclase which will result in pka being activated. Phospholipase c system! (i. e. ligand binding to membrane receptor g protein dissociates activates phospholipase c pip2 breaks down dag + ip3 +p enzyme. Contact-dependent integrin receptors: when activated, cause structural changes in cytoskeleton. Know what creb is (increase in camp pka creb nuclear response element changes in gene expression. Hormone can affect what cell processes (i. e. apoptosis) Anterior vs posterior pituitary (which one is a true endocrine gland of epithelial origin vs extension of neural tissue of the brain that secretes neurohormones made in the hypothalamus?) Na/k atpase: 3 na+ out for ever 2 k+ in.
